It's three days a week: Friday-Saturday-Sunday.

And, frankly, that works fine for them. It wouldn't benefit them much to run lousy cards on Thursdays in front of nobody.

And Lambo's right, too. Keep in mind, they were subsidized by AC casinos for more than 30 years, until it was taken away after the 2010 season. So the fact that they've been able to put in a solid program for four seasons now is pretty impressive.
